Neighbourhood sales statistics

Glenwood

How to read: Share of sales in each ~$50k price band for “glenwood” (Detached houses (non-condo), 2024). The tallest band is the mainstream budget range; multi-year view shows how that band shifts over time.

Data summary (Winnipeg / glenwood / Detached houses (non-condo) / 2024): ~$50k bands. The largest share is $550K–$600K (about 20.0%). Second-largest band: $350K–$400K (about 18.8%); top two together about 38.8%. About 85 sales in this view (sample size check).

Property Summary: 152 Imperial Avenue, Winnipeg

Key Characteristics & Appeal

This two-storey home in Glenwood offers a practical blend of modern convenience and manageable scale. Built in 2013, it is a notably newer construction compared to most Winnipeg homes, suggesting contemporary building standards and potentially lower immediate maintenance. With 1,344 sqft of living space, it provides ample room for a small family or couple, ranking above average for size within its immediate neighborhood and street. Its assessed value is also consistently above average for the local area, indicating a solid standing in the market.

The primary appeal lies in this modern efficiency on a smaller, low-maintenance lot. While the land area is compact relative to city and neighborhood averages, this translates to less yard work and a focused living space, which can be a significant advantage for busy professionals or those looking to downsize without sacrificing a modern home. The property suits first-time homebuyers seeking a move-in-ready, newer build, or practical investors attracted by a modern asset in a stable neighborhood. It's a home for those who prioritize the condition and interior space of the dwelling over a large outdoor parcel.
